Henning Larsen is a brand that deals with architecture, landscape, urban development, graphic design, interior, and lighting design and works globally on the core principles of sustainability and innovation constantly adapting to global trends. The firm was founded by Danish Architect Henning Larsen in 1959. The firm follows the legacy of creativity and learning and gives direction to the complex connections that bind together the built environment, environments, and societies.

About the Founder – Henning Larsen
Henning Larsen was a Danish architect, after completing his studies he commenced his architectural practice in collaboration with a fellow architect but soon in 1959 he set up his own architectural firm and earned international recognition. Later, he joined the Royal Danish Academy of Fine Arts as a professor of architecture.
In the 1980s, Larsen launched the architectural journal SKALA, which he published for ten years. He also established the SKALA Architecture Gallery, which operated until 1994.
Henning Larsen’s approach was both analytical and artistic, with a strong emphasis on natural light in his buildings. He utilised light and space as powerful tools in his design process.

Impact
Henning Larsen’s design and energy-efficient philosophy have positively impacted the environment in several ways. These include decarbonizing for net-zero emissions through the use of natural materials in construction and ventilation systems, as seen in Feldballe School. Additionally, the firm emphasises preserving biodiversity and ecosystems, inviting wildlife back into urban areas, exemplified by Bishan Ang Mo Kio Park. They advocate for proper resource management and a circular economy by reusing or recycling materials, and they strive to create resilient, livable societies.

Henning Larsen Brand
In January 2020, Henning Larsen joined forces with Ramboll Group (a global architecture, engineering, and consultancy company) to expand their reach and explore the scope of sustainability with the help of experts who produce sustainable solutions across various sectors, including Buildings, Transport, Energy, Environment & Health, Water, Management Consulting, and Architecture & Landscape.
This partnership has resulted in performance efficiency as it merges the architectural design philosophy of Henning Larsen and the engineering excellence of Ramboll, and attains innovative, flexible, and functional excellence in buildings.

Collaboration of the brands handles complex projects, pushes the boundaries of architecture and engineering, and significantly impacts the global built environment.
PhD students from the Technical University of Denmark are employed for research, working on various projects related to sustainable design. Their goal is to integrate sustainability into the design and building elements from the very beginning of each project.

The journey from firm to brand
In 1959, Henning Larsen established the firm in Copenhagen, the aim was to shape the future, he fueled the firm with a design philosophy of sustainability and innovation, and to design the livable spaces that would endure over time. Early projects like the Ministry of Foreign Affairs building in Riyadh helped establish the firm’s reputation for quality and earned international fame.
Henning Larsen Architects consistently produced designs known for their creativity and functionality. Notable projects such as the Harpa Concert Hall in Reykjavik and the Moesgaard Museum in Aarhus have become landmarks, further enhancing the firm’s reputation.

The firm is identified as a leader in green architecture as sustainability is the core principle navigating its projects. Its reach goes beyond Denmark, to Europe, the Middle East, and Asia.
